A Chinese advert for laundry detergent has been winning attention for all the wrong reasons, with at least one commentator describing it as “jaw-droppingly racist.”
The commercial, for the Qiaobi detergent brand, begins with a woman loading her washing machine. A black man in paint-splattered clothes appears, who then wolf-whistles and winks at the woman.
She beckons him over, then pushes him into the machine – and he emerges, to the woman’s delight, as a Chinese man in clean clothes. According to Shanghaiist, the advert reflects widespread attitudes in China: “As any foreigner who has ever lived in China can attest, attitudes regarding race and skin color are often quite different here from back home. Still even with prior experience, sometimes this country can leave you completely and utterly dumbfounded.
